**CI note: timezone weirdness in report exports**

Heads up, support folks — if a customer says their Ledgerpine export shows times shifted by a few hours, it's probably the CI image. The export workers got rebuilt last week and the base image defaults to UTC, while older workers used the account's locale. Fix is rolling out; meanwhile tell customers the data itself is fine, just the display offset. Affected exports carry the build token shown below.

build token for bajof-tahop: htk4_a981

Team,

The FieldHawk telemetry gateway candidate is staged for review. This build changes the CAN-bus frame batching window from 250ms to 400ms to reduce uplink chatter from the Brindleford test combines, and adds retry backoff for the soil-moisture probe channel. Please pay particular attention to the buffer reuse in the batching path; I flagged two spots where ownership is subtle. All integration suites passed on the Harrowvale bench rig. The exact build token is below for traceability.

build token for kagaf-hahof: htk14_9d3d4d26d7d8de

Quick context for the weekly sync: we're mid-migration from the old Mortlake build scripts to the hermetic Kilnworks system, and the signing account got wedged when its sandbox lost network access (by design, ironically). To recover: re-pin the toolchain manifest, rerun the bootstrap target, and re-authenticate the signing account from a trusted workstation. That last step prompts for the account's recovery passphrase, which we keep on record immediately below this fragment.

recovery phrase for bawep-kawef: oliath-casdor

Scope: retire the punch-card model; move all Fenwick Stores branches to the points-based Kestrel Rewards 2.0 platform.

Timeline: pilot at the Ashgrove branch next quarter; full rollout two quarters later.

Actions for branch managers:
- Audit outstanding punch-card balances.
- Nominate one staff trainer per branch.
- Flag any till-system issues to the rollout desk.

Do not communicate details to staff until the pilot results are reviewed. A confidential note on wider business plans follows below.

board note of kafog-bajep: Briathek Partners is in early talks to buy Aldaelek Group for about $47.1 million. The Ulaath launch date is September 4, and nothing goes to the press before then.